Consistency, consequences, self-management
Last night I forgot to take my medication. Slept badly. Woke up feeling rough. Mood’s off. Energy’s low. It’s easy to overlook the basics when things are going well. But this is the reality: small habits → big impact For me, sleep and medication aren’t optional extras. They’re foundations. Today’s just a reminder: Look after the basics, even when you feel “fine”. Because it catches up with you when you don’t.
